Job Description

The Commercial Forward Impact Engineering and Engagement Product Manager drives innovation by closely working with Commercial business stakeholders and team of engineers to translate prioritized business opportunities into rapid prototypes and minimum viable products (MVPs). This role blends business engagement with technical execution, enabling Pfizer to accelerate delivery, reduce complexity, and create measurable value. Operating at the intersection of Commercial business priorities, technical design, and product delivery, Product Manager advances concepts into validated solutions that enable decision making on further scale across the enterprise. The role has responsibility for managing stakeholder relationships, shaping product strategies, and ensuring solutions meet both technical rigor and customer needs. The role focuses on hands-on product leadership—establishing clear product vision, strategy, and roadmaps, and ensuring that prototypes and MVPs are built, tested, and refined efficiently.
